题名 | 网驰平台统一部署框架的设计与实现 |
学位类别 | 硕士 |
答辩日期 | 2009-06-04 |
授予单位 | 中国科学院研究生院 |
授予地点 | 中科院软件所5号楼6层会议室 |
导师 | 魏峻 |
关键词 | 组件模型 |
其他题名 | The Design and Implementation of Once Unified Deployment Framework |
中文摘要 | 随着软件技术的发展,越来越多的应用系统采用组件技术来提高系统开发效率。企业级应用通常通过集成多种组件形成复杂软件,完成业务功能。各种组件之间存在直接或者间接的依赖关系以及配置限制,使得当前以手工为主的组件部署效率低下且容易出错。 针对分布式组件系统部署面临的问题,论文建立了一种基于约束规则的统一部署框架,支持各种组件的统一一致的自动化部署。论文首先分析总结了组件部署现状,设计了一种统一部署描述模型,刻画不同组件的部署需求,包括部署单元、部署目标、以及约束规则,为部署计划正确性验证以及自动部署提供基础。针对组件部署中缺乏提前验证的问题,论文还设计了一套基于约束规则的验证机制。通过总结当前多种组件平台中领域相关的约束规则,对约束规则进行分类,并使用声明式对象约束语言(Object Constraint Language)刻画约束规则。为不同类型约束设计了验证算法,并且设计了包含约束规则验证活动的组件部署流程。最后论文给出了网驰平台统一部署系统OnceUD的设计与实现,将前述研究成果引入其中,并通过应用案例评估了系统的功能。 |
语种 | 中文 |
学科主题 | 软件理论 |
公开日期 | 2009-06-11 |
内容类型 | 学位论文 |
源URL | [http://124.16.136.157//handle/311060/90] ![]() |
专题 | 软件研究所_软件工程技术研究开发中心 _学位论文 |
推荐引用方式 GB/T 7714 | . 网驰平台统一部署框架的设计与实现[D]. 中科院软件所5号楼6层会议室. 中国科学院研究生院. 2009. |
个性服务 |
查看访问统计 |
相关权益政策 |
暂无数据 |
收藏/分享 |
除非特别说明,本系统中所有内容都受版权保护,并保留所有权利。
修改评论